IMG_5970I bought a hiking book from Costco the other day and I was eager to try it out – I found one hike on Cougar Mountain that I thought would be fun (De Leo Wall), so we called our friends and everyone met there – Asher, Laura, Terry, Christina, and us. It took a bit longer to drive there than I anticipated – probably because we don’t know our way around that part of Bellevue/Issaquah, but nevertheless, we made it there and started hiking. Well it wasn’t much of a hike – more of a walk along an old logging trail, but eventually we found our trail.

IMG_5979The book pegged Cougar Mountain as a great getaway close to home, or something like that, but it was kind of ridiculous. Whoever maintains the mountain has decided that more trails is better, which I would normally agree with, except for when one actually tries to hike and HAS to use a map to try to figure out which trail to take and even then feels completely lost… There were trails everywhere! We were trying to find a lookout and we didn’t realize that we’d actually found the lookout until we got home and looked up the hike on the web. Whatever. The hike had no destination (or a letdown of a destination), and we decided after that hike that we like having something to hike to – a beautiful lookout or waterfall or SOMETHING!
